Guō Màoqiàn 郭茂倩 (1041–1099)
A Northern-Sòng official from Yúncheng 鄆城 (Shāndōng — though some sources give Tàiyuán 太原), eldest son of the courtier Guō Yuán 郭源 of the Qízhōu lineage. Jìnshì of approximately Xīníng 4 (1071). He served as Hénán fǔ fǎcáo cānjūn and later as a senior official in the Tàicháng (Court of Sacrifices) before retiring to compile the Yuèfǔ shījí 樂府詩集 KR4h0034 — the comprehensive 100-juǎn anthology of yuèfǔ (musical/song) poetry from antiquity to the late Táng. The book is the principal pre-modern Chinese anthology of song-poetry and remains the foundational source for yuèfǔ studies.
